About Anderby Creek

Anderby Creek is a quaint holiday village located on the North Sea coast in Lincolnshire, just north of Skegness. Situated within the parish of Anderby, it lies approximately 4 kilometres (2.5 miles) from Chapel St Leonards and is renowned for its caravan parks and holiday retreats, making it a key area for tourism and planning applications related to leisure and residential developments.

Ecology & Nature Designations

The area around Anderby Creek includes 1 Sites of Special Scientific Interest (SSSI): Sea Bank Clay Pits SSSI; 1 Special Protection Areas (SPA): Greater Wash. These designations may affect planning decisions, as proposals near protected sites require environmental impact assessment and may face additional restrictions.

Planning Activity in Anderby Creek

In the last 24 months, 8 planning applications were submitted near Anderby Creek. Of these, 86% were approved, with an average decision time of 60 days.

This is broadly in line with the national average of approximately 87%. Anderby Creek maintains a standard approach to planning decisions.

At 60 days on average, decisions near Anderby Creek slightly exceed the 8-week statutory target for minor applications, though this is common across many councils.

The most common application types near Anderby Creek were full planning applications (4), amendments (2), outline applications (1). Full planning applications account for 50% of all submissions, covering new builds, change of use, and works that go beyond permitted development rights.
